Timberwolves Nearly Traded for Jaylen Brown Before LaMelo Ball Blockbuster

Summary

The Charlotte Hornets traded LaMelo Ball and Josh Green to the Minnesota Timberwolves for Naz Reid and several future draft picks. Before this deal, Minnesota also talked with the Boston Celtics about trading for Jaylen Brown but chose Ball because they needed a point guard more.

Key Facts

  • The Hornets sent LaMelo Ball and Josh Green to the Timberwolves.
  • Minnesota gave up Naz Reid and multiple future draft picks, including an unprotected first-round pick in 2033.
  • The Timberwolves created a young backcourt with LaMelo Ball and Anthony Edwards, both 24 years old.
  • Minnesota considered trading for Jaylen Brown from the Boston Celtics but decided against it.
  • Ball was preferred as he fits the Timberwolves’ need for a point guard better than Brown.
  • The Timberwolves want to keep Jaden McDaniels, a key player for them.
  • The Celtics have been in talks about trading Brown with multiple teams interested.
  • The trade aims to help Anthony Edwards by reducing his offensive burden with Ball’s playmaking skills.
